Twill Media is a design company based in Brighton, UK. We provide a custom design service across a wide variety of digital mediums. We enable businesses and individuals to deliver goods and services to the right people, in the right way, at the right time. We seek to implement new and effective design solutions, all within the confines of available time and budget.
We are pleased to work closely with other leading design companies, including Kineo, leaders in the field of rapid e-learning.
